JSS Search

Supplier Governance Manager - Financial Services

Job Location

London,, United Kingdom

Job Description

The Supplier Governance Manager will oversee supplier governance, due diligence, and procurement processes, ensuring alignment with regulatory standards and internal policies. Maintain and improve the Procurement Policy; ensure consistent application across the business, including compliance with DORA and other regulatory obligations. Lead supplier segmentation, due diligence, and risk assessments; coordinate reviews and support performance monitoring with appropriate SLAs and KPIs. Support sourcing, tendering, negotiations and management of procurement tools. Lead reporting to internal governance groups and support local entity requirements. Engage cross-functional teams to ensure the function adds value. Identify opportunities for cost savings, efficiency, and improved supplier performance. To be considered: Supplier Manager / Vendor Manager / Supplier Governance Manager from Financial Services. Good knowledge of financial services regulations across UK and EU (FCA, PRA, DORA). Excellent stakeholder management. On Offer £70,000 - £85,000 plus attractive benefits. Hybrid: 3 days / week in London.

Location: London,, GB

Posted Date: 7/19/2025
View More JSS Search Jobs

Contact Information

Contact Human Resources
JSS Search

Posted

July 19, 2025
UID: 5301620559

AboutJobs.com does not guarantee the validity or accuracy of the job information posted in this database. It is the job seeker's responsibility to independently review all posting companies, contracts and job offers.